Sam Machonis went 2-4, sparking the Mohawk Valley DiamondDawgs (1-0) to a 6-3 victory over the Albany Dutchmen (0-1) on Friday at Veterans Memorial Park.
He singled in the first and sixth innings.Anthony Herrera baffled the Albany Dutchmen, striking out six batters. The Mohawk Valley DiamondDawgs' pitcher tossed three innings of shutout ball and allowed only three hits.
Michael Bollmer was hot from the plate for the Albany Dutchmen. Bollmer went 3-4 and scored one run. He singled in the second, fourth, and ninth innings.
Payton Coddou improved to 1-0 on the year by picking up the win for the Mohawk Valley DiamondDawgs. He allowed three runs over six innings. He struck out six, walked two and surrendered six hits.
Gavin Wallace (0-1) took the loss for the Albany Dutchmen. He allowed six runs in 6 2/3 innings, walked none and struck out six.
